RICHMOND, Va. (WRIC) — Nearly six years after Virginia Tech student Morgan Harrington went missing after a Metallica concert, her alleged killer has been charged with her murder.

Jesse Matthew is now accused of attacking three women over the past 10 years, killing two of them.

“We are very relieved that we have the perpetrator, he’s behind bars and justice will have its way,” said Gil Harrington, the mother of Morgan Harrington.

Justice that has been five years, 11 months in the making — on October 17, 2009, Morgan Harrington attended a concert at the John Paul Jones Arena in Charlottesville when she disappeared.

“I would have loved to have seen, you know she would be 26 now, how she turned out, we’ll never see that. Never see what kind of babies she would have made,” said Harrington.

In the months after her body was found, sketch’s of the alleged suspect were released.

On Tuesday, the Albemarle County Commonwealths Attorney saying they believe they can prove those sketches are Jesse Leroy Matthew. Jr.

“You can’t do something as evil as kill someone and suffer no consequences — there must be consequences,” said Harrington.

Gil and Dan Harrington say the fact that an arrest has been made isn’t all good news because the fact remains their daughter is dead.

“I have thoughts of how could someone hurt Morgan — Morgan was so sweet and nice, how could you snuff her out. Why?” asked Harrington.

And now a new chapter. On Wednesday, the first court proceedings will begin. Matthew is set to be arraigned on Abduction with the Intent to Defile and First Degree Murder. That happens at 12:45 p.m..

And, just as she has for every court proceeding for other cases Matthew has been apart of, Gill Harrington will be there, this time looking at the man officials say saw Morgan when she breathed last.

Matthew is also charged with Capital Murder in the September 2014 disappearance and death of 18-year-old University of Virginia student Hannah Graham.

8News reached out to Jesse Matthew’s defense team, but have yet to receive a response.
